Understanding 1.4301 & 1.4307 Stainless Steel Round Bar Properties
Exploring the properties of 1.4301 and 1.4307 stainless steel round rod requires a understanding into the makeup . 1.4301, frequently known as 304 stainless material, and 1.4307, which goes by 304L, these offer superior corrosion durability and good weldability. Despite sharing like origins, 1.4307 incorporates the lower C , leading to enhanced ductility and minimized susceptibility to weld decay – especially important during heat applications. Consequently, choosing between these varieties copyrights on a specific application and required operational parameters .
